On Penguins and Thermodynamics

As predicted, here's another in the chemistry poetry book illustration series. In the thermodynamics chapter, one of the poems likens NO2 molecules to penguins. They huddle together for warmth, but then are pleasantly surprised to find that they react with each other to make N2O4. The exothermic reaction gives them their desired warmth after all.
